Our school

Our school works with: immigrant population, in a situation of economic disadvantage, with special educational needs. We also receive several students belonging to the LGTBIQ+ community.

We also have a radio equipment from which we record very interesting programs.

Apart of arts, our school also likes science, which is why we celebrate science week, in which other schools visit us to see incredible experiments. We also have a graduate of Science.

We are the only school with a graduate of arts (scenics and plastics) in the region, therefore, many people from the surrounding towns come to study here.

There are 652 students and 75 teachers in our school. It is a pretty big school.

Our school was founded in 2005, less than 20 years ago, so it is quite recent.

Las migas are a traditional and humble dish, typical of the gastronomy of Extremadura. They are made with crumbled hard bread, garlic, La Vera paprika, olive oil and accompaniments such as chorizo, bacon, torreznos or fried peppers.

Holy Week in Badajoz

Holy Week in Badajoz, declared of National Tourist Interest, stands out for its solemn processions, traditional brotherhoods and devotion to the Virgen de la Soledad, patron saint of the city.

The Roman influence in Extremadura is reflected in its architectural legacy, such as the Roman Theater of Mérida, aqueducts and roads, and in its cultural, administrative and economic impact, which endures in the region.

"Extremeño" has some exceptions in the language, such as:-Some gender changes in words.-The omission of the "r" and "l" at the ends of words.-The use of expressions, such as , "Acho", which means a wake-up call, or "Arrecío", which means being very cold.

OUR DIALECT "EXTREMEÑO / CASTÚO"

Extremadura is made up of steppes and pastures. We have two types of vegetation: Mediterranean vegetation and deciduous vegetation, having all the types of ecosystems; acuatic, terrestial, mixed and artificial. There we have a lots of types of animals, and some of them are in danger of extinction, such as, the Iberian lynx, the griffon vulture, the black vulture, the black stork and the imperial eagle.
